Raw material is screened, dried to a specific moisture level, and ground to a uniform size. Then, this blend of sawdust is compressed and formed into a very dense, dry, and consistent wood pellet. According to the EPA, Pellet fuel has been proven to provide the cleanest burn of any solid fuel.
